Profile
John Burgess is currently the Chairman at Taylor Devices, Inc., the Non-Executive Chairman at StrataTech Education Group, the Director at Bird Technologies Group, Inc., and the Director at Tulsa Welding School, Inc. Previously, he served as the Chairman, President & Chief Executive Officer at Reichert, Inc. from 2002 to 2007.
He also held the position of Chief Operating Officer at International Motion Control, Inc. from 1996 to 1999.
Additionally, he was the President of the Ophthalmic & Educational Division at Leica Microsystems GmbH and the President of Moog Japan Ltd.
Mr. Burgess obtained an undergraduate degree from the University of Bath and an MBA from Canisius College.
